| Plan | Details |
|---|---|
| Free | Free audit access – available on most courses and specializations. Includes lecture videos and some course readings. Graded assignments and certificates are not available on audit access. |
| Individual_certificate | Individual course certificates – priced per course or specialization. Unlocks graded assignments, peer review, and a shareable certificate upon completion. Verify current pricing at coursera.org. |
| Coursera_plus | Coursera Plus subscription – provides access to most courses, specializations, and professional certificates under a single monthly or annual subscription. Verify current subscription pricing at coursera.org. |
| Coursera_for_teams | Coursera for Teams and Coursera for Business – organizational subscription for assigning and tracking employee learning across the full catalog. Custom pricing based on team size. Contact Coursera for details. |
Coursera provides free audit access to lecture videos and some course materials on most courses. Graded assignments and certificates require paid enrollment. Individual certificate courses are priced separately. Coursera Plus is a subscription plan that provides access to most courses and specializations for a monthly or annual fee. Professional certificate programs are priced as multi-course specializations. Users should verify current pricing, subscription options, and free audit availability at coursera.org.
Quick Summary
Coursera is an online learning platform that offers a structured library of AI, machine learning, and data science courses, specializations, and professional certificates developed in partnership with universities including Stanford and institutions including Google, DeepLearning.AI, and IBM. It is designed for working professionals seeking to develop or formalize AI and machine learning skills for career advancement, students supplementing academic study with applied technical training, and organizations upskilling teams in areas including generative AI, MLOps, and natural language processing. The platform uses a freemium model where course content can be audited for free, with graded assignments, certificates, and specialization credentials available through paid access.

Who should use Coursera?
Discover practical workflows and real-world scenarios where Coursera delivers key solutions.
A software engineer completes Andrew Ng's Machine Learning Specialization on Coursera to formalize ML knowledge and earn a credential that demonstrates applied programming ability to prospective employers.
A data analyst enrolls in the Google Data Analytics and Google Machine Learning Engineer professional certificate programs to develop skills for a role transition into applied ML engineering.
A non-technical product manager completes a Generative AI literacy course to understand LLM capabilities and limitations well enough to make informed product decisions and communicate effectively with engineering teams.
A university student uses Coursera's free audit access to work through Deep Learning Specialization content alongside their academic coursework, practicing Python implementations before their semester projects.
A company uses Coursera for Teams to assign AI literacy and prompt engineering courses to a marketing department, tracking completion across the team and issuing certificates to employees who finish the designated learning path.
